What Is Security Awareness Training and Why Is It Critical for Your Business?
Security awareness training is a structured program designed to educate employees about cybersecurity threats, safe practices, and the measures necessary to protect corporate data and infrastructure. It is an ongoing process that transforms employees from potential vulnerabilities into active defenders of your digital assets.
In an era where cyber attacks such as phishing, ransomware, and social engineering are increasingly sophisticated, relying solely on technological solutions is insufficient. Human error remains the leading cause of security breaches. Therefore, training your staff effectively not only mitigates risks but also aligns your organization with compliance requirements such as GDPR, HIPAA, and PCI DSS.

Key Components of Effective Security Awareness Training
- Comprehensive Curriculum: Covering topics such as phishing, password security, data privacy, social engineering, mobile security, and incident reporting.
- Engaging Delivery Methods: Utilizing e-learning modules, interactive simulations, videos, and gamification to enhance retention and engagement.
- Regular Refreshers: Conducting ongoing training sessions to keep employees updated on emerging threats and best practices.
- Simulated Attacks: Running mock phishing campaigns to assess readiness and reinforce training messages.
- Personalized Training Programs: Tailoring content to different roles and departments to address specific risks and responsibilities.
- Metrics and Reporting: Measuring the effectiveness through assessments, feedback, and incident tracking to continuously improve the training program.
Implementing a Successful Security Awareness Training Program
Step 1: Assess Your Current Security Posture
Begin by evaluating your existing cybersecurity measures, identifying vulnerabilities, and understanding the threat landscape specific to your industry and organization.
Step 2: Define Clear Objectives
Set measurable goals such as reducing phishing click rates, improving password management, or enhancing incident reporting speed.
